这个试题是2022年NOC大赛编程马拉松赛道Python高年级A卷真题,包含答案解析。
红色字体我标记为参考答案,蓝色字体为答案解析
2022NOC-Python编程马拉松赛道复赛高年级A卷正式卷
1:运行下面的代码,程序输出的结果是?
m= 1+2
print(m)
A、m
B、1+2
C、3
D、12
2:运行下面的代码,程序输出的结果是?
m=4+3%5
print(m)
A、4
B、7
C、9
D、6
运行结果是 7,即选项 B。
解释:
-
在第一行代码中,计算表达式
4+3%5的值。注意,Python 中%是取模操作符,它的优先级高于加法操作符+,因此在计算时应先计算3%5的值,再将其结果与

本文提供了2022年NOC大赛编程马拉松Python高年级A卷的真题及详细答案解析,涵盖Python基础知识、运算符优先级、字符串与列表操作、循环与条件判断等内容,帮助参赛者理解并掌握相关知识点。
订阅专栏 解锁全文
5811

被折叠的 条评论
为什么被折叠?



